HomeMy WebLinkAboutReso 24-1975 RESOLUTION NO. 24-75 CITY COUNCIL, CITY OF SOUTH SAN FRANCISCO, STATE OF CALIFORNIA A RESOLUTION .AMENDING BUDGET FOR FISCAL YEAR 1974-75 AND APPROVING SUPPLEMENTAL BUDGET APPROPRIATIONS. BE IT RESOLVED by the .City Council of the City of South San Francisco that the Council, having received and duly considered the staff report dated February 19, 1975, a copy of which is attached hereto as Exhibit A and incorporated herein by said reference as if set forth verbatim, does approve the supplemental budget appropria- tions 1974-75 and orders the amendment of the budget for fiscal year 1974-75 as recommended, and does further order the transfer of funds from the unallocated balance, Parking District Fund; unallocated balance, General Fund; and unallocated balance, Capital Improvement Fund to the respective funds as therein set forth and in the sums therein set forth, which total Eighty-eight Thousand Nine Hundred Seventy-six Dollars ($88,976).
